If you are experiencing blurred or cloudy vision, double vision, or a sensitivity to light, then you should visit your optometrist right away. These symptoms may mean that you have a cataract, which can progressively get worse if it is not treated. All too often people live with cataracts when they do not have to. They may mistake their vision changes as normal signs of aging, but that is not the case. Although cataracts are more common as you age, they are not normal in any way, and you do not have to deal with them. No matter how old you are, you should not be limited by cataracts. The surgery that is done to get rid of them is usually safe for people of all ages because it is not invasive and it does not require general anaesthesia.
